This site is like a library, use search box in the widget to get ebook that. Unit 1 register transfer and microoperations register. Register transfer language, bus and memory transfers, arithmetic, logic and shift microoperations. Size and complexity of the system can be varied as per the requirement of today. Register transfer and microoperations arithmetic computer. Lecture 14 let s put together a manual processor hardware lecture 14 slide 1 the processor inside every. The term register transfer implies the availability of hardware logic circuits that can perform a stated microoperation and transfer the result of the operation to the same or another register. Different types of microoperations computer architecture. Arithmetic microoperations, which perform arithmetic on data in registers. These type of micro operations are used to transfer from one register to another binary information. Summary of register transfer microoperations a b transfer content of reg. If you paid the pdfill registration fee and received a registration number from plotsoft, l. I the registers it contains i operations done on data stored in them microoperations nada sharaf lecture 1. Mar 31, 2015 register transfer copying the contents of one register to another is a register transfer a register transfer is indicated as r2 r1 in this case the contents of register r2 are copied loaded into register r1 a simultaneous transfer of all bits from the source r1 to the destination register r2, during one clock pulse note.
Computer organization and architecture microoperations. Microoperations can be expressed in terms of a register transfer language rtl. Stored program organization and instruction codes, computer registers, computer instructions, timing and control, instruction cycle, memoryreference instructions. Logic microoperations can be used to manipulate individual bits or a portion of a word in a register consider the data in a register a. Yoon simple digital systems combinational and sequential circuits learned in chapters 1 and 2 can be used to create simple digital systems. Register transfer and microoperations chapterwise computer. Download pdf computer organization mcqs with answers on register transfer and microoperations. Chapter 4 introduces a register transfer language and shows how it is used to express microoperations in symbolic form. Digital logic design by m morris mano 2nd edition pdf free. How to download computer system architecture by morris mano pdf.
Register transfer and microoperation linkedin slideshare. Digital logic design by m morris mano 2nd edition pdf. Ugc net syllabus for computer science 2020 updated. Logic microoperations, which perform bit manipulation on data in registers. Register transfer and microoperations free download as powerpoint presentation. The sequence of register transfers is controlled by the control subsystem. A register can be viewed as a single entity or may also be represented showing the bits of data they contain. Transfer microoperations, which transfer binary data from one register to another.
Register transfer and microoperations 32 other logic microoperations 6. Simple digital systems are frequently characterized in terms of the registers they contain, and. For any function of the computer, the register transfer language can be used to describe the sequence of microoperations register transfer language a symbolic language a convenient tool for describing the internal organization of digital computers can also be used to facilitate the design process of digital systems. The microoperations most often encountered in digital systems are of four types. Postgraduate course electrical engineering department college. Computer system architecture third edition by morris mano. Shift microoperations perform shift operations on data stored in registers. Register transfer and microoperations 3 the function table of the above bus system is s 1 s 0 register collected 0 0 a 0 1 b 1 0 c 1 1 d the construction of a bus system with three state table buffers is shown in the following figure. Implies availability of logic circuits for performing mos and and transfer results of the operations to another or same register. The internal hardware organization of a digital computer is best defined by specifying the set of registers it contains and their functions the sequence of microoperations performed on the binary information stored the control that initiates the sequence of microoperations use symbols, rather than words, to specify the sequence of microoperations. Computer system architecture third edition by morris mano pdf. The operations on the data in registers are called microoperations. Computer organization pdf notes co notes pdf smartzworld.
In computer central processing units, microoperations also known as a microops. The operation of the device can be designed as a sequence of register transfers can be designed using state diagrams, asm charts, etc. Register transfer and microoperations computer science. Computer registers computer instructions instruction cycle. Jul 27, 2018 register transfer and microoperations. Trying to describe the design in words is pure folly. To introduce the simple architecture in the next section, we first examine, in general, the microarchitecture that exists at the control level of modern computers. A free powerpoint ppt presentation displayed as a flash slide show on id. Digital systems are composed of modules that are constructed. Register transfer registers are designated by capital letters followed by optional number. Top a read operation implies transfer of information to the outside environment from a memory word, whereas. Sep 12, 2019 chapter 4 introduces a register transfer language and shows how it is used to express microoperations in symbolic form. Register transfer is defined as copying the content of one register to another.
Registers can be designated by a whole register, portion of a register, or a bit of a register. The control that initiates the sequence of microoperations. Draw and explain the diagram of micro program sequencer. A composite arithmetic logic shift unit is developed to show the hardware design of the most common microoperations. The transfer of information from bus to one of many register can be accomplished by connecting bus lines to the inputs of all register and activating the load signal of required one. Mar memory address register pc program counter ir instruction register registers and their contents can be viewed and represented in various ways a register can be viewed as a.
These microoperations are used to perform on numeric data stored in the registers some arithmetic operations. Symbols are defined for arithmetic, logic, and shift microoperations. Register transfer level digital systems are designed using a modular approach modules are connected with data and control paths a module is best describes using. An insert operation is used to introduce a specific bit pattern into a register, leaving the other bit positions unchanged this is done as a mask operation to clear the desired bit positions, followed by an or operation to introduce the new bits into the desired positions. Here five mcq questions with answers are added and each question contain four options as possible answer but only one option is the correct answer. Download free computer system architecture, register transfer microoperations course material and training pdf reading habits in children pdf file 35 pagesby which data is transferred from one register to another is called micro operation.
Manipulating part of a register manipulating individual bits. Oct 30, 2014 the transfer of information from bus to one of many register can be accomplished by connecting bus lines to the inputs of all register and activating the load signal of required one. Register transfer bus and memory transfers, arithmetic micro operations, logic micro operations, shift micro operations, arithmetic logic shift unit. Register transfer language rather than specifying a digital system in words, a specific notation is used, register transfer language for any function of the computer, the register transfer language can be used to describe the sequence of microoperations register transfer language a symbolic language. A no pipeline system takes 50 ns to process a task. Download as ppt, pdf, txt or read online from scribd. Click download or read online button to get computer arithmetic and verilog hdl fundamentals book now. Register transfer and micro operations pdf chapter 4 register transfer and microoperations. Download computer system architecture morris mano 3rd. Register transfer language register transfer language, rtl, sometimes called register transfer notation is a powerful high level method of describing the architecture of a circuit.
The symbolic notation used to describe the microoperation transfers amongst registers is called register transfer language the term register transfer means the availability of hardware logic circuits that can perform a stated microoperation and transfer the result of the operation to the same or another register. Simple digital systems are frequently characterized in terms of the registers they contain, and the operations that they perform. Registers computer architecture tutorial studytonight. Here you can download the free lecture notes of computer organization pdf notes co notes pdf materials with multiple file links to download. Register transfer and microoperations computer data. These are the lowlevel building blocks of a digital computer. Here five mcq questions with answers are added on registers, addressing modes etc. Register transfer and micro operations 31 other logic. Register transfer language the symbolic notation used to describe the microoperation transfers among registers is called a register transfer language. Register transfer language register transfer language rather than specifying a digital system in words, a specific notation is used, register transfer language for any function of the computer, the register transfer language can be used to describe the sequence of microoperations register transfer language a symbolic language.
Computer system architecture morris mano 3rd edition prentice hall. Digital logic design by m morris mano 2nd edition pdf free download book description this book has been on the market for many years which in itself seems like a good sign, and when it comes to learning the fundamentals of digital design, it is hard to find a better reference. Designate computer registers by capital letters to denote its function. The symbolic notation used to describe the microoperation transfer among registers is called rtl register transfer language. Download pdf covers computer architecture and organization objective questions with answers on register transfer and microoperations. A register transfer language is a type of hardware description language hdl since a cpu is a synchronous sequential circuit, microoperations occur at regular intervals when triggered by the clock pulse. Computer system architecture by morris mano pdf free download. Register transfer and micro operation linkedin slideshare. They can be used to store and transfer the data from the registers by using instruction. Postgraduate course electrical engineering department. Computer organization and architecture microoperations execution of an instruction the instruction cycle has a number of smaller units fetch, indirect, execute, interrupt, etc each part of the cycle has a number of smaller steps called microoperations discussed extensive in pipelining microops are the fundamental or atomic. Register transfer copying the contents of one register to another is a register transfer a register transfer is indicated as r2 r1 in this case the contents of register r2 are copied loaded into register r1 a simultaneous transfer of all bits from the source r1 to the destination register r2, during one clock pulse note. Here the concept of digital hardware modules is discussed. Register transfer and micro operations computer organization tcs 303tit 304 outline register transfer bus transfer memory transfer micro operations this chapter.
Micro operations pdf chapter 4 register transfer and microoperations. A composite arithmetic logic shift unit is developed to show the hardware design of. The computer organization notes pdf co pdf book starts with the topics covering basic operational concepts, register transfer language, control memory, addition and subtraction, memory hierarchy. Download pdf covers computer architecture and organization objective questions with answers on register transfer and micro operations. Each transfer must correspond to a sequence of microoperations. Micro operations pdf micro operations pdf micro operations pdf download. Scribd is the worlds largest social reading and publishing site.
Rtl describes the transfer of data from register to register, known as microinstructions or microoperations. A abus r1, r2 abus transfer content of r1 into bus a and, at the same time, transfer content of bus a into r2. The sequence of microoperations performed on the binary information stored in the registers. Register transfer and microoperations philadelphia university. Rtl is a system for expressing in symbolic form the micro operation. The register transfer microoperation was introduced in sec. If we need to insert a pattern into some bits of a register assume register a having bits. Rtlis set of symbolic notations used to describe micro operations, transfer among registers. If we need to transfer the content of register c to register r1, it can be represented as. Ppt register transfer and micro operations powerpoint. Vhdl code and schematics are often created from rtl. The internal hardware organization of a digital computer is best defined by specifying. Computer arithmetic and verilog hdl fundamentals download. Chapter 4 register transfer and microoperations section 4.
635 1580 404 589 494 1506 342 329 613 559 730 1252 217 1187 1317 110 546 702 876 211 1241 871 1450 891 1360 246 556 760 663 45 767 103 1038 647 991